Why does Dr. king argue that African Americans can no longer wait to demand equal rights?

Answer:Dr Martin Luther King gives several reasons why the African American can no longer wait to demand equal right.

Explanation: (1) Disillusionment with the slow speed of school desegregation

(2) Lack of confidence in politicians and government, particularly after the

perceived failures of the Kennedy administration.

(3)The Great Depression never ended for African Americans; while others

enjoyed an economic recovery, Black unemployment rose.

(4) perception of the American Negro as downtrodden and powerless

(5) Emancipation Proclamation reminded Blacks that they remained

oppressed in spite of their nominal legal freedom.

Exit What did the 22nd Amendment do?
miss Akunina [59]

The 22nd Amendment sets the term limit for election to the office of President of the United States.

The Amendment states that;

<em>"No person shall be elected to the office of the President more than twice and no person who has held the office of President, or acted as President, for more than two years of a term to which some other person was elected President shall be elected to the office of President more than once."</em>
